In January, rioters also attacked police and set fires on the streets of Rotterdam after a curfew came into force. It was one of the worst outbreaks of violence in the Netherlands since coronavirus restrictions were first imposed last year. Riot police and a water cannon restored calm after midnight. Photos from the scene showed at least one police car in flames and another with a bicycle slammed through its windshield. Police combing through video footage from security cameras expect to make more arrests. “They shot at protesters, people were injured,” Aboutaleb said. Mayor Ahmed Aboutaleb told reporters in the early hours of Saturday morning that “on a number of occasions the police felt it necessary to draw their weapons to defend themselves” as rioters rampaged through the port city’s central shopping district, setting fires and throwing rocks and fireworks at officers. One police officer was hospitalized with a leg injury sustained in the rioting, another was treated by ambulance staff and “countless” others suffered minor injuries. Officers in Rotterdam arrested 51 people, about half of them minors, police said Saturday afternoon. The condition of the injured rioters was not disclosed.
